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Starbeck to Gowerton start from as little as £32.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Starbeck to Gowerton start from £193.50 one way, or £194.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Starbeck to Gowerton are available for £74.50 one way, or £149.00 return

Station Details and Amenities

Starbeck Station offers a range of ticketing and travel assistance facilities to cater to your needs. Though there isn't a ticket office, ticket machines are readily available for purchasing and collecting tickets, including those bought online. For the tech-savvy traveler, smartcards are issued and validated at the station for a seamless travel experience.

While the station is not staffed, customers can reference helpful screens for departure information and announcements. Phone assistance is available if you require it, but do note the absence of a waiting room, luggage storage, or CCTV. The good news is, however, that step-free access is provided to both platforms, making it a category B station with mobility scooter compatibility. Do be aware that toilet and baby changing facilities are not available, so plan accordingly.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Getting around from Starbeck station is straightforward thanks to several transport links. Rail replacement services are conveniently located at bus stops near the level crossing. For easier travel around town, taxis are accessible through this service.

Those looking to explore the lovely surrounds of Starbeck and nearby destinations can benefit from the Transdev Harrogate & District bus services, making it easier to access various towns and villages around Harrogate. Consider purchasing a PLUSBUS ticket alongside your train ticket for unlimited bus travel across Starbeck and its neighboring areas, offering excellent value. For more information on bus service routes and timetables, you can visit Harrogate and District.

Facilities and Amenities

Gowerton Train Station, though modest in size, is equipped to cater to basic travel needs. While it doesn't have a staffed ticket office, it features ticket machines that make purchasing and collecting tickets a breeze. These machines are conveniently accessible for everyone, with touchscreen interfaces and induction loops for hearing aid users.

The station proudly offers step-free access throughout, ensuring accessibility to both platforms via a footbridge with ramps. While it lacks waiting rooms and restroom facilities, it compensates with a seating area for weary travelers. For those with bicycles, the station offers a sheltered storage area with CCTV, safeguarding your bike while you're off exploring Wales.
